本文目录导读:
随着互联网技术的飞速发展,.NET框架作为一款强大的开发平台,得到了广泛的应用,在.NET框架中,服务器控件作为核心组成部分,极大地提高了Web开发效率,本文将深入解析.NET服务器控件的功能、应用以及未来趋势,帮助开发者更好地掌握这一技术。
.NET服务器控件概述
.NET服务器控件是一种基于类的组件,它封装了用户界面元素和逻辑,使得开发者能够方便地在ASP.NET应用程序中创建动态网页,服务器控件具有以下特点:
1、可重用性:服务器控件可以跨多个页面和应用程序重用,降低了开发成本。
2、易于维护:服务器控件将用户界面和逻辑分离,便于维护和升级。
图片来源于网络,如有侵权联系删除
3、丰富的功能:.NET提供了大量的服务器控件,满足不同场景下的需求。
4、事件驱动:服务器控件通过事件驱动的方式实现交互,增强了用户体验。
.NET服务器控件的功能与应用
1、常用服务器控件
(1)TextBox:文本框控件,用于输入和显示文本。
(2)Button:按钮控件,用于触发事件。
(3)Label:标签控件,用于显示文本信息。
(4)CheckBox:复选框控件,用于选择多个选项。
(5)RadioButton:单选按钮控件,用于选择一个选项。
图片来源于网络,如有侵权联系删除
(6)ListBox:列表框控件,用于显示多个选项供用户选择。
(7)ComboBox:下拉列表框控件,用于选择一个选项。
(8)Image:图片控件,用于显示图片。
(9)GridView:数据网格控件,用于显示和编辑数据。
(10)FormView:表单视图控件,用于显示和编辑单个数据记录。
2、服务器控件应用实例
(1)登录界面:使用TextBox、Button、Label等控件实现用户登录功能。
(2)商品列表:使用GridView控件展示商品信息,并支持分页、排序等功能。
图片来源于网络,如有侵权联系删除
(3)表单验证:使用服务器控件实现表单验证,提高用户体验。
(4)数据绑定:使用数据绑定功能,将数据源与服务器控件绑定,实现动态数据展示。
未来趋势
1、个性化定制:随着用户需求的多样化,服务器控件将更加注重个性化定制,满足不同场景下的需求。
2、智能化:利用人工智能技术,服务器控件将具备更强的智能化能力,如自动推荐、智能搜索等。
3、跨平台:随着移动设备的普及,服务器控件将实现跨平台支持,满足不同设备的需求。
4、高性能:服务器控件将不断优化性能,提高响应速度,提升用户体验。
.NET服务器控件作为.NET框架的重要组成部分,为Web开发带来了诸多便利,本文对.NET服务器控件的功能、应用及未来趋势进行了深入解析,希望对开发者有所帮助,在未来的发展中,服务器控件将继续发挥重要作用,推动Web技术的发展。
标签: #.net服务器控件
评论列表